Saudi Arabia, 2008.
A girl is attempting to file for divorce, but has been denied the right by Saudi courts.
The husband is 58 years old. The girl is 8. The motion was filed on her behalf by her divorced mother, after the girl’s father agreed to marry her off for a dowry of $10,000.
“The judge has dismissed the plea because she [the mother] does not have the right to file, and ordered that the plea should be filed by the girl herself when she reaches puberty,” lawyer Abdullah Jtili told the AFP news agency.
